sharePsychology is overrated in poker. Keeping a "poker face", should be the least of your worries if you are a new player. A quick tip is if you are worried about looking nervous and are involved in a big hand, keep your eyes fixated on a spot on the table and don´t look anywhere else, until the hand is over. The most important part of poker is learning the fundamentals. In poker, you should always count your stack in "big blinds". This is basically the first step before learning about everything else.
